Why Buy Real Estate in Florida
Market values of properties in the sunshine state have been declining because of the market crash that happened in the United States. However, the state is now on the stage of recovery, and it is expected that right now is the time to buy as market values are expected to rise in the years to come.
Aside from this market opportunity, there are other reasons many people are looking to buy real estate in Florida. For one, buying houses in Florida has become an easy task because of realtors or real estate agents. Not only do they help you in searching for your ideal property, but they also take on all the legal requirements, thus eliminating the need for lawyers.
Secondly, there is a wide range of options to choose from. Beachfront houses at the Palm Beach can cost more than a million dollars, but condominium units at Florida`s developing business districts can be available for $100,000 or less. A third reason many are considering buying homes in the sunny state is because of the low tax levels in Florida. There is actually no state income tax in Florida, and local sales tax rates are still lower than other cities.
